PM Modi thanks Trump for birthday wishes; backs U.S.’ Ukraine peace push

U.S. President Donald Trump on Tuesday (September 16, 2025) dialled Prime Minister Narendra Modi and greeted him on his 75th birthday, in a significant gesture seen as part of Washington’s efforts to reset ties with New Delhi.

In a social media post, PM Modi said, like Mr. Trump, he is also “fully” committed to taking the India-U.S. Comprehensive and Global Partnership to “new heights”.

“Thank you, my friend, President Trump, for your phone call and warm greetings on my 75th birthday,” the Prime Minister said.

“Like you, I am also fully committed to taking the India-U.S. Comprehensive and Global Partnership to new heights,” he said.

“We support your initiatives towards a peaceful resolution of the Ukraine conflict,” he added. Mr. Trump’s call to wish PM Modi on his birthday came a day before the Prime Minister’s 75th birthday.

Mr. Trump also thanked PM Modi for his support in ending the war between Russia and Ukraine.

“Just had a wonderful phone call with my friend, Prime Minister Narendra Modi. I wished him a very Happy Birthday! He is doing a tremendous job. Narendra: Thank you for your support on ending the War between Russia and Ukraine!” he posted on Truth Social.

Mr. Trump signed off the message with “President DJT”, underscoring its personal tone.
